target=_blank>Customs Seizes N5.3bn Drugs Smuggled From Canada At Tincan Port

The Nigeria Customs Service (NCS), Tin Can Island Port Command, has intercepted two containers laden with motor vehicles used to conceal significant quantities of illicit drugs worth N5.3 billion. The Customs Area Controller of the command, Comptroller Frank Onyeka, highlighted the seizures as a testament to the command’s resolve to safeguard Nigeria’s borders and ensure…

target=_blank>Customs Arrests Suspect With N562.5m Hard Drug Along Seme Road

The Nigeria Customs Service (NCS), Federal Operations Unit (FOU), Zone A, has arrested a suspect, Nduak Monday, with a hard drug suspected to be Crystal Methamphetamine, weighing 25 kilograms. The intercepted substance with a street value of N562. 5 million was made along the Gbaji- Seme road by the roving officers of the unit, who…
